πŸ“˜ What’s Covered in This Exercise?

Exercise 2.5 from Chapter 2 – Polynomials involves the use of advanced algebraic identities to simplify and solve complex expressions. This includes identities like:

πŸ“Œ Identities You Will Use:

  • (x + y + z)² = x² + y² + z² + 2xy + 2yz + 2zx
  • x³ + y³ + z³ – 3xyz = (x + y + z)(x² + y² + z² – xy – yz – zx)
  • Other identity-based expansions
